Output 5cb80539a41414c177f2df86913c9e41ea4fc023b016081b6108337681eb06a8:0

value
138685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d32f2ef1bfe3d11dd2595b3c19805f5fea41af4 OP_EQUAL
address
MSc9nkXcWcoKdrvbM9T9okGTUTugeZUvau
transaction
5cb80539a41414c177f2df86913c9e41ea4fc023b016081b6108337681eb06a8
spent
true